Volleyball Recap: Waxahachie Prep Warriors vs. Westwood Wildcats

After flying high against Winston School of Dallas last Thursday, Waxahachie Prep came back down to earth. The Waxahachie Prep Warriors lost 3-0 to the Westwood Wildcats on Thursday. The Warriors were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Wildcats apparently hadn't forgotten their loss the last time these teams played back in October of 2016.

Waxahachie Prep was held off the scoreboard, but that almost wasn't the case: they kept the second set very close.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-21, 25-22, 25-11.

Even though they lost, Waxahachie Prep kept the net locked down and finished the game with 12 blocks. That's the most blocks they've posted since back in September.

Waxahachie Prep's defeat ended a five-game streak of away wins and brought them to 11-12. As for Westwood, their win (their first of the season) made their record 1-3.

Waxahachie Prep will face off against Providence Academy at 6:00 p.m. on Monday. As for Westwood, they will square off against Winston School of Dallas at 6:00 p.m. on Friday.
